Skip to content
  • Home
  • Recent
  • Tags
  • 0 Unread 0
  • Categories
  • Unreplied
  • Popular
  • GitHub
  • Docu
  • Hilfe
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
ioBroker Logo

Community Forum

donate donate
  1. ioBroker Community Home
  2. Deutsch
  3. Skripten / Logik
  4. Blockly
  5. Wert aus Viessmannapi in in knx übernehmen

NEWS

  • Jahresrückblick 2025 – unser neuer Blogbeitrag ist online! ✨
    BluefoxB
    Bluefox
    17
    1
    2.5k

  • Neuer Blogbeitrag: Monatsrückblick - Dezember 2025 🎄
    BluefoxB
    Bluefox
    13
    1
    993

  • Weihnachtsangebot 2025! 🎄
    BluefoxB
    Bluefox
    25
    1
    2.3k

Wert aus Viessmannapi in in knx übernehmen

Scheduled Pinned Locked Moved Blockly
1 Posts 1 Posters 227 Views 1 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• G Offline
    G Offline
    gospelrock
    wrote on last edited by gospelrock
    #1

    Hallo,
    ich bin ganz neu hier und komme momentan an einem simplen Punkt nicht weiter.
    Ich habe u.a. den script-adapter, viessmannapi und knx installiert und möchte die Werte aus viessmannapi (die kommen dort auch tatsächlich an) auf den knx-Bus senden. Dazu habe ich die entsprechenden KNX GAs angelegt und habe in blockly über "binde Objekt" beides eingetragen.
    Hier mal der Code dazu:

    on({id: 'viessmannapi.0.heating.circuits.0.sensors.temperature.supply.value', change: "any"}, function (obj) {
    setState('knx.0.Klima.Wärmepumpe.Vorlauftemperatur', obj.state.val);
    });

    Oder den Block:
    <block xmlns="http://www.w3.org/1999/xhtml" type="direct" id="GOP(rZh0r/!ZWioXfd9D" x="-1487" y="-312">
    <field name="ONLY_CHANGES">FALSE</field>
    <value name="OID_SRC">
    <shadow type="field_oid" id="1Y2+.^[1e.dB=jT6TvB^">
    <field name="oid">viessmannapi.0.heating.circuits.0.sensors.temperature.supply.value</field>
    </shadow>
    </value>
    <value name="OID_DST">
    <shadow type="field_oid" id="zRSVh*-w;oL)b/!79itY">
    <field name="oid">knx.0.Klima.Wärmepumpe.Vorlauftemperatur</field>
    </shadow>
    </value>
    </block>

    In der viessmannapi-Instanz sehe ich, dass er die Werte eingelesen hat.
    In der KNX-Instanz steht aber weiterhin eine "0". Er übernimmt also die Werte nicht in die KNX-Instanz. :-(
    Was mache ich falsch?

    Noch etwas zur Umgebung: Bei mir läuft der ioBroker auf einem Timberwolf-Server 950Q (ARMv7) in einem Container.

    Für Hinweise wäre ich sehr dankbar!

    Peter

    1 Reply Last reply
    0
    Reply
    • Reply as topic
    Log in to reply
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es


    Support us

    ioBroker
    Community Adapters
    Donate

    436

    Online

    32.6k

    Users

    82.3k

    Topics

    1.3m

    Posts
    Community
    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en | Einwilligungseinstellungen
    ioBroker Community 2014-2025
    logo
    • Login

    • Don't have an account? Register

    • Login or register to search.
    • First post
      Last post
    0
    • Home
    • Recent
    • Tags
    • Unread 0
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e